A Taco Bell customer’s illness from Cyclospora has sparked a major legal and public health firestorm—Edgar Mercado, 50, says he lost his job after severe vomiting and diarrhea linked to contaminated lettuce, now suing the chain and supplier Taylor Farms. His lawyer represents 300 others in Illinois, pushing for accountability and answers on how fecal contamination slipped through, as officials warn this outbreak is unusually widespread—with nearly 1,000 cases and hospitalizations reported. Experts note the parasite’s resilience and the need for cooking produce, while critics point to understaffed federal agencies slowing response. Mercado, thankfully recovering with hydration alone, is just one of many victims in what could become a landmark case.
